Question:
A standing wave results from the sum of two transverse traveling waves given by y1 = 0.050 cos (πx – 4 πt) and y2 = 0.050 cos (πx + 4πt), where x, y1, and y2 are in meters and r is in seconds.
(a) What is the smallest positive value of x that corresponds to a node? Beginning at t = 0, what is the value of the
(b) First,
(c) Second, and
(d) Third time the particle at x = 0 has zero velocity?
